Tyco Electronics Micro-Strip
connectors are a high
density, controlled
impedance connector
family compatible with the
requirements of high den-
sity and high speed data
transmission technologies.
Each signal line within the
mated connector is located
at a specific distance from
an integral, separable bus
bar serving as a ground
plane in a micro-strip
configuration. The selection
of housing dielectric,
spacing from signal
contact-to-ground plane
and conductor geometry
provide a specific charac-
teristic impedance plus
very low inductance and
capacitance.
Discontinuities resulting
from connector structure
and solder interfaces are
dimensionally small and
therefore appear transpar-
ent to high speed signals.
Both vertical and right-
angle board-to-board and
cable-to-board connector
versions share a nominal
impedance of 50 ohms
(single ended) or 100 ohms
(differential pair).
Each one inch length of
connector houses two elec-
trically isolated high current
contacts. When soldered to
the PC board ground plane,
that ground plane is
extended through the
mated connector.
Resistance is minimized
by a large contact area and
short electrical length, pro-
viding signal return paths
with negligible ground loop
voltages. Since signal
return is via the bus bars,
signal-ground-signal
alternation, common to
high speed applications,
becomes unnecessary. All
contacts can be dedicated
to signal transmission,
effectively doubling
connector density.
